Patrick Davis (born December 28, 1986 in Sterling Heights , Michigan ) is an American ice hockey player who last played at KalPa Kuopio in the Liiga on the position of the left winger .

Career

Patrick Davis began his career as a hockey player with the Detroit Belle Tire , for which he was active from 2002 to 2003 in the US amateur junior division Midwest Elite Hockey League . Then the winger went to the Sioux City Musketeers in the United States Hockey League . After spending a season there, the offensive player joined the Canadian junior team Kitchener Rangers , with whom he was active in the Ontario Hockey League . There, the right-handed shooter developed into a goal-scoring player over the course of the next three years and scored 41 goals and 44 assists in 108 games of the regular season , which earned him a total of 85 points. During the 2005/06 season he also completed a total of 45 games for league rivals Windsor Spitfires and scored 59 points.

In the same season Davis was also for the Albany River Rats , the then farm team of the New Jersey Devils , active in the American Hockey League and completed three games in which he remained pointless and received two penalty minutes. In the 2005 NHL Entry Draft , Davis was selected in the fourth round at a total of 99th position by the New Jersey Devils. The following two seasons he spent exclusively with the Lowell Devils in the AHL and was able to increase his point yield. During the 2008/09 season , the winger made his NHL debut for the Devils, which was also his only use that season. During the 2009/10 season Davis was an integral part of the Lowell Devils team and also played eight games for the New Jersey Devils in the National Hockey League , in which he scored his first goal in the NHL.

In February 2011, Davis and Michael Swift were swapped to the San Jose Sharks in exchange for the Devils Jay Leach and Steven Zalewski . He spent the 2011/12 season with Grizzly Adams Wolfsburg in the German Ice Hockey League , before completing a trial training session at HK ZSKA Moscow from the Continental Hockey League in August 2012 and finally receiving a contract.
